What Is Herbal Skin Care Essential Oil Blends?
Herbal skin care essential oil blends are mixtures of various essential oils derived from aromatic plants, herbs, and flowers. Each oil contains unique compounds that can contribute to skin health, offering a range of benefits depending on their individual properties. Popular essential oils used in skin care include lavender, tea tree, chamomile, and rosemary, among others. These oils can be combined in various ratios to create blends tailored to specific skin concerns or conditions.
The process of extracting essential oils typically involves steam distillation, cold pressing, or solvent extraction, resulting in highly concentrated substances that capture the essence of the plant. When formulated into blends, these oils can work synergistically, enhancing their therapeutic effects.
Key Benefits and Properties
Herbal skin care essential oil blends offer a myriad of benefits, thanks to the diverse properties of the individual oils. Here are some key benefits and properties commonly associated with these blends:
1. Antimicrobial Properties: Many essential oils possess antimicrobial qualities, making them effective in preventing and treating skin infections. For instance, tea tree oil is well-known for its antibacterial and antifungal properties.
2. Anti-inflammatory Effects: Essential oils like chamomile and lavender can help reduce inflammation and soothe irritated skin, making them ideal for sensitive or inflamed conditions.
3. Moisturizing and Hydrating: Certain oils, such as jojoba and argan oil, are rich in fatty acids and can help moisturize and nourish the skin.
4. Astringent Qualities: Oils like rosemary and sage can help tighten and tone the skin, making them suitable for oily or acne-prone skin.
5. Soothing and Calming: Many herbal essential oils have calming effects that can reduce stress and anxiety, contributing to a holistic approach to skin health.
6. Wound Healing: Some essential oils, such as helichrysum, are known for their regenerative properties and can support the healing of wounds and scars.
Common Uses
Herbal skin care essential oil blends can be employed in various applications, ranging from topical treatments to incorporation into daily skin care routines. Here are some common uses:
1. Facial Serums: Blends can be added to carrier oils to create nourishing serums that target specific skin concerns, such as dryness, acne, or aging.
2. Moisturizers: Essential oil blends can enhance commercial moisturizers or be used in homemade formulations to boost hydration.
3. Bath Oils: Adding essential oil blends to bathwater can create a relaxing and skin-nourishing experience.
4. Body Scrubs: Combined with exfoliating agents like sugar or salt, essential oils can enhance the benefits of body scrubs, leaving skin smooth and refreshed.
5. Massage Oils: Blends can be diluted in carrier oils for use in massage, providing both skin benefits and relaxation.
6. Facial Masks: Incorporating essential oils into clay or yogurt-based masks can enhance their detoxifying and nourishing properties.

Safety Considerations
While essential oils offer numerous benefits, it is essential to handle them with care. Here are some important safety considerations:
1. Dilution: Essential oils should always be diluted in a carrier oil before applying them to the skin to avoid irritation. Common carrier oils include jojoba, sweet almond, and coconut oil.
2. Patch Testing: Before using a new essential oil blend, conduct a patch test by applying a small amount to a discreet area of skin to check for any allergic reactions or sensitivities.
3. Avoiding Sensitive Areas: Essential oils should not be applied near sensitive areas such as the eyes or mucous membranes.
4. Pregnancy and Nursing: Certain essential oils may not be safe for pregnant or nursing individuals. It is advisable to consult a qualified professional before use.
5. Children and Pets: Some essential oils can be harmful to children and pets. Always research the safety of specific oils before use in households with young children or animals.
Storage and Shelf Life
Proper storage is crucial to maintain the quality and efficacy of herbal skin care essential oil blends. Here are some guidelines:
1. Dark Glass Containers: Store essential oil blends in dark glass bottles to protect them from light, which can degrade the oils.
2. Cool, Dry Place: Keep oils in a cool, dry environment, away from direct sunlight and heat sources.
3. Tightly Sealed: Ensure that bottles are tightly sealed to prevent oxidation and evaporation.
4. Shelf Life: The shelf life of essential oils can vary. Generally, most essential oils have a shelf life of 1 to 3 years, while blends may have a shorter lifespan depending on their composition.

3. Are there any essential oils I should avoid?
Certain essential oils, such as citrus oils, can increase photosensitivity and should be used with caution. Research specific oils and their recommended uses to ensure safety.
